New Shower: Question about sloped mortar bed
I am doing my first shower. I have been getting as much advice as possible. The house is on a concrete slab and I plan to use the Kerdi system. I am ready to put in the sloped mortar bed. I have read in several places that this should be constructed of sand and portland cement at a near 5 to 1 ratio. I have also read that you don't want to use mason's mortar because it has lime in it. I have plenty of Quikrete mortar mix available (green label in 60 lb bags). I would like to know if this is suitable or not. It says it contains portland cement and sand, but I can't find the ratio and whether or not it has any lime in it. Why should lime not be included? Just curious. I understand how to mix dry pack mortar and feel like this product will work. By reading some of the other threads, I think I should add some sand, but I figured it would be best to run it by this group first.
